Understanding the Basics of Chicken Road
The basics of chicken road revolve around the core mechanics that govern the game. Players take control of a chicken on a dangerous path where they must step from one oven to another, with each step bringing new opportunities and risks. The objective is not just to survive but to accumulate the highest rewards possible.
The game begins with a relatively low risk, allowing players to grasp the controls and mechanics easily. As they progress, they encounter various ovens that increase the game’s stakes. The design of these levels ensures that players are always pushed to their limits, where they must calculate their moves wisely. A player might survive several jumps, but one wrong move could lead to becoming a crispy chicken.
There are complicating factors to the straightforward mechanics of chicken road. For instance, the timing of each jump is crucial. Players need to gauge not only the distance to each oven but also the timing of the flames that erupt from them. This aspect introduces a rhythm to the game, intensifying its overall fun and excitement.

Game Mechanics
Understanding the mechanics of chicken road is essential for any player looking to excel in the game. The control system is straightforward, with players using simple taps or swipes to maneuver their chicken. However, the challenge lies in the timing and rhythm required to jump successfully without getting toasted.
Each level introduces new dynamics, such as varying speeds of flames or tricky pathways that force players to adapt quickly. As players advance, they begin to appreciate the nuances of the controls, leading to improved performance over time. This learning curve contributes significantly to the excitement of the game, as players find themselves getting better and better.
Aside from the primary mechanics, players can also earn bonuses and power-ups that enhance their jumps or protect them momentarily from the dangers ahead. These incentives help maintain a competitive edge and encourage players to strive for higher scores.
